Basically, my friend showed me this program a few days ago and I am totally hooked! It's amazing what it can accomplish, and I wanted to show the 411 community this nifty little thing called Terragen :P

It is a terrain generating program that can create some amazingly realistic renders if done correctly (or you can make alien-like scenes).

I currently have the unregistered version, which limits your renders to 1280 x 960 resolution :( But it is free, so it's only fair. Registering allows you to enable better antialiasing, as well as increase the resolution (I am not sure how much it costs to register).

Terragen 2 takes things to a whole new level, and I assume it is very expensive (I didn't look at the price), since it allows trees and structures that are more complicated than hills.

As for understanding Terragen 2, I've looked through many tutorials to get my knowledge. I wouldn't say I understand most of it, but I understand a large chunk, and that link I posted earlier (Terragen 2 Node Reference (http://www.planetside.co.uk/docs/tg2/noderef/application.html?MenuState=HA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AA AA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AEAAAABcVVVBAEAAAAEAAAAAAAAAAAA AA)) is very helpful.

This scene started off as a ripoff of this tutorial (http://www.terragen.org/index.php?action=tpmod;dl=item342) but doesn't much resemble it anymore.

The landscape is mostly composed of a painted shader tied to a displacement shader to create a canyon depression, then a few power fractals rough up the terrain. I then have a twist and shear shader to make the rock sort of spike out as you can see, and then a strata and outcrops shader causes it to be somewhat tiered or plateau-y.
